The Complete Timeline and Cause of the Disney Dream Incident

The incident occurred on Sunday, June 29, while the Disney Dream cruise ship was sailing in international waters, returning to Fort Lauderdale, Florida, after a four-night cruise.

The victim, a five-year-old girl, was on Deck 4—an outdoor promenade—with her mother and father.

The critical moments unfolded around 11:30 a.m.

  • The Setup: New reports and court documents indicate the mother had instructed the girl to pose for a photograph near an open porthole on the ship's Deck 4.
  • The Fall: The girl reportedly lost her balance while sitting on a railing near the porthole, causing her to fall backward.
  • The Exit Point: She fell through the open porthole and into the ocean, plunging into the Atlantic waters below.

This sequence of events highlights a dangerous combination of factors: a child climbing on a railing, an open porthole, and a momentary lapse in balance, all compounded by the act of posing for a picture in a restricted area.

The Heroic Rescue and Aftermath on the High Seas

The immediate reaction from the girl's father was one of selfless heroism, which ultimately saved both their lives.

Upon seeing his daughter fall, the father immediately jumped into the ocean after her.

The cruise ship crew, alerted to the "man overboard" situation, initiated rescue protocols. The girl and her father were both successfully recovered from the water shortly after the fall.

The prompt action of the father and the swift response from the Disney Dream crew were critical to the positive outcome, as survival time in the open ocean can be limited, especially for a small child.

Why the Mother Was Not Charged

Following the traumatic event, an investigation was launched by the Broward Sheriff’s Office. The focus was on whether the mother's actions—specifically, encouraging the child to pose near the porthole—constituted child neglect.

Florida prosecutors ultimately decided not to file child neglect charges against the mother.

The decision was based on the finding that the incident, while tragic, did not meet the legal threshold for criminal negligence. This outcome, though final in the legal sense, has sparked significant public debate regarding parental responsibility and supervision on cruise ships.

Cruise Ship Safety Regulations and the Man Overboard Problem

The incident on the Disney Dream sheds light on two critical aspects of maritime safety: the physical barriers on deck and the technology designed to detect a person falling overboard.

The Role of Railing Height and Design

Cruise ship railings are mandated by international regulations and industry standards to be a minimum height.

  • International Standard: The Cruise Vessel Security and Safety Act (CVSSA), a U.S. law, requires cruise ship railings to be at least 42 inches (3.5 feet) tall.
  • Safety Intent: This height is intended to prevent accidental falls by adults and to deter children from climbing over the barriers.
  • Disney Dream Deck 4: Deck 4 on the Disney Dream is a popular outdoor walking track. The area is clearly marked with signs warning passengers not to climb or sit on the rails, reinforcing that the deck’s design, while compliant, is not intended for climbing.

In this case, the fall occurred not by simply leaning over a railing, but by the child climbing onto the rail and falling through a separate aperture—the open porthole—a highly unusual and preventable circumstance.

Man Overboard (MOB) Detection Systems

A key entity in modern maritime safety is the Man Overboard (MOB) detection system, which uses advanced technology like motion sensors, radar, or thermal cameras to automatically detect a body leaving the ship.

The distressing reality is that despite regulations, fewer than 2% of current cruise ships are equipped with genuinely effective, ISO-compliant MOB detection systems.

In this particular incident, police noted that the five-year-old child's body was too small to set off the ship's existing "man overboard" sensors, underscoring the limitations of current technology, especially concerning small children.

The low rate of successful recovery in known overboard cases—fewer than 19%—highlights the urgent need for cruise lines to fully integrate and optimize this technology to improve passenger safety and situational awareness.
